一直在这里搜索和谷歌超过一个小时,似乎无法找到答案.
我有一个从包含变量的数据库查询返回的字符串,但是看起来这些字符串都是单引号返回的,因此变量不会被评估,如果它是双引号的话.
从sql查询返回的是$ result:
这不会评估2个变量:
$myname = 'david';
$occupation = 'Beginner';
$result = 'Hello my name is $myname and I my occupation is $occupation';
echo $result;
Run Code Online (Sandbox Code Playgroud)
这将评估2个变量:
$myname = 'david';
$occupation = 'Beginner';
$result = "Hello my name is $myname and I my occupation is $occupation";
echo $result;
Run Code Online (Sandbox Code Playgroud)
我的问题是如何将单引号字符串转换为双引号字符串,它能够评估变量?
谢谢
当我想用XPath打印evaluate表达式的结果时,我有错误.
$ url = $ xpath-> evaluate('// a/@ href',$ event); echo $ url;
我有这个错误:可捕获的致命错误:类DOMNodeList的对象无法转换为字符串
我的代码:
<?php
// Get the HTML Source Code
$url='http://www.parisbouge.com/events/2012/05/01/';
$source = file_get_contents($url);
// DOM document Creation
$doc = new DOMDocument;
$doc->loadHTML($source);
// DOM XPath Creation
$xpath = new DOMXPath($doc);
// Get all events
$events = $xpath->query('//li[@class="nom"]');
// Count number of events
printf('There is %d events<br />', $events->length);
// List all events
for($i = 0; $i < ($events->length); $i++) {
$event = $events->item($i);
$url = $xpath->evaluate('//a/@href', …Run Code Online (Sandbox Code Playgroud) 我正在使用此功能(它返回文本DK001位于ID范围内的行)
Found = Application.Evaluate("=IF(ID=""DK001"",ROW(ID),""x"")")
Run Code Online (Sandbox Code Playgroud)
我想将搜索条件(例如DK001)作为字符串提供,例如
Found = Application.Evaluate("=IF(ID=SearchString,ROW(ID),""x"")")
Run Code Online (Sandbox Code Playgroud)
我无法创建一个被接受为搜索条件的字符串。我需要您的帮助!我究竟做错了什么?
这个评估功能困扰着我....
如果我现在想向函数发送一个值(而不是字符串)怎么办?
Found = Application.Evaluate("=IF(ID=1,ROW(ID),""x"")")
Run Code Online (Sandbox Code Playgroud)
以上作品!
但是如果我希望这是一个像
Found = Application.Evaluate("=IF(ID=MyValue,ROW(ID),""x"")")
Run Code Online (Sandbox Code Playgroud)
然后怎样呢?
我有一个查询和一个字段/列名称列表.我想做一个双循环 - 遍历查询中的每个记录,然后循环遍历字段/列名称列表并输出每个相应的字段.循环应该是这样的:
<table>
<cfoutput query="myQuery">
<tr>
<cfloop list="#cols#" index="col">
<td>?</td>
</cfloop>
</tr>
</cfoutput>
</table>
Run Code Online (Sandbox Code Playgroud)
问题是在问号所在的位置...我已经尝试过#myquery[col]#,但这没有用.我需要获取变量中字符串名称所指示的变量col......显然,#col#只会返回列名.我需要找出一些方法来对字符串进行双重评估......就像##col##这样,当然也不会有用.我怎么能做到这一点?
我有以下字符串:
data = ["myKey": "myValue"]
Run Code Online (Sandbox Code Playgroud)
并希望将其评估为地图:
def map = evaluate(data)
Run Code Online (Sandbox Code Playgroud)
看起来我做错了但是得到了
groovy.lang.MissingMethodException: No signature of method: DUMMY.evaluate() is
applicable for argument types: (java.lang.String) values: [["myKey": "myValue"]]
Run Code Online (Sandbox Code Playgroud)
所以我的问题是如何进行这样的评估?
我正在尝试确定是否定义了具有变量名称的变量.请帮助我的语法......到目前为止我的尝试:
<cfif isDefined(Evaluate("session['#url.sessionSQL#']['SQL_ALL']"))>
<cfif isDefined('Evaluate("session[#url.sessionSQL#]")["SQL_ALL"]')>
<cfif isDefined(Evaluate("session['#url.sessionSQL#']['SQL_ALL']"))>
<cfif isDefined('session[Evaluate("#url.sessionSQL#")]["SQL_ALL"]')>
<cfif isDefined('session["#url.sessionSQL#"]["SQL_ALL"]')>
Run Code Online (Sandbox Code Playgroud)
谢谢.
例如,如果我有一个函数f(x)=x^2,我该如何评估它x=2?我尝试使用符号工具箱并在命令窗口中使用以下代码:
syms x;
f = sym(x^2);
subs(f,x,2);
Run Code Online (Sandbox Code Playgroud)
但我只是在第一行得到这个错误:
Undefined function 'syms' for input arguments of type 'char'.
我是Matlab的新手,仍在研究语法,所以我可能会遇到语法错误.但是,我也有学生试用版,所以我认为不能使用符号工具箱.有什么方法可以定义f(x)和评估它x=2吗?
我想通过VBA使用它-
=MATCH("PlanA",A:A,0)
Run Code Online (Sandbox Code Playgroud)
与EVALUATE。
Sub Test()
Dim SectionStartRow As Integer
Dim planname As String
planname = "PlanA"
SectionStartRow = [MATCH(planname,A:A,0)] 'Error 2029 /// Type mismatch '13
End Sub
Run Code Online (Sandbox Code Playgroud)
我已经尝试过:
SectionStartRow = Evaluate("MATCH(planname,A:A,0)") 'Error 2029 /// Type mismatch '13
Run Code Online (Sandbox Code Playgroud)
和
SectionStartRow = Evaluate("MATCH(" & planname & ",A:A,0)")
Run Code Online (Sandbox Code Playgroud)
但似乎没有任何效果。请注意,planname一长串函数拒绝使用变量。
我希望得到一个列表,列出所有要评估的值,true或者false使用差等式检查!=,==甚至是if()
我有一个列表,我收集了多年,但它与我的PC死了
我是一名初学 Clojure 程序员。在 Book 中,Clojure 的一个优点是不求值的代码是数据。但是我不理解。所以,我想要一个示例代码和一个解释,以便我能理解。
我是韩国人。因此,即使我写了一个尴尬的句子或未能保持我的礼貌,如果你能理解,我将不胜感激。
evaluate ×10
coldfusion ×2
excel ×2
php ×2
vba ×2
clojure ×1
domdocument ×1
domxpath ×1
dynamic ×1
excel-match ×1
function ×1
groovy ×1
javascript ×1
lisp ×1
math ×1
matlab ×1
quotes ×1
variables ×1
xpath ×1